Sam And The Haunted House

One sunny afternoon, Sam Brown’s family were off-roading in their ute. They were heading to Golden Lake with Sam’s brother Tim, his Mum and his Dad. Golden Lake was the most famous lake in England.
Suddenly, their car came to a holt. Sam looked out of his window and what he saw made his tummy flip with fear. There was a thick fog and through it he saw a dark figure crossing the road towards a scary looking house. Sam was perfectly scared, but Tim insisted that they had better risk going through the fog if any of them wanted to see the Lake.
They drove really slowly through the fog. Then a lightning bolt flashed, and their car stopped dead! Sam’s heart started to beat fast, though only for a second. Before them was a rusted titanium wall, about one hundred metres tall, at least that was what Sam estimated. The next moment all they could hear was the clanking of pistons, and the huge wall started moving upwards. It looked like it hadn’t been touched in hundreds of generations.
On the other side of the wall was a room. It was as big as a large mansion. It was quite a simple room. It had an arm chair, a wooden table and a photo of a grumpy old giant mouse. The photo was hanging above the table by a chain made of mouldy cheese. The boys went to explore the far end of the room while their parents explored the sides of the room.
Tim leant on the arm chair and it suddenly crumbled into small pieces, revealing a trapdoor. Tim told the others to come down with him but his parents said that if anyone was going down the hole it was Sam ad Tim.
So, Sam and Tim clambered down the rusty old ladder, lining the side of the hole. About half an hour later, the boys finally got to the bottom of the ladder when suddenly hundreds of lasers burst out of the stone walls of the cavern. One singed Tim’s hair!
Then Sam saw the dark figure he had seen in the mist, dodging the lasers! He was VERY skilled. Finally, after a few minutes (that seemed like hours) of dodging the lasers themselves, they found an exit. It was damp and cold, and a tight squeeze, but surprisingly the tunnel didn’t last long.
Soon they found a ladder up to another trapdoor. The boys burst out of the trapdoor….and out into the depths of the Golden Lake. Sam picked up a handful of pebbles. That’s when he figured out why Golden Lake is called Golden Lake. The pebbles were balls of solid gold!
The boys started swimming towards the surface. There, they found their Mum and Dad! They went home rich, but they never took that road to Golden Lake again.
